picker是一种常见的用户界面组件,用于让用户从一组选项中进行选择。在前端开发中,特别是使用 JavaScript 和框架(如 React、Vue 或原生 JavaScript)时,动态创建picker可以根据用户的交互或其他条件来生成选择器。 相关优势 灵活性:可以根据应用的状态或用户的输入动态生成选项。
class Picker { DEFAULT_DURATION = 200; MIN_DISTANCE = 10; DEMO_DATA = []; // demo数据 // 惯性滑动思路: // 在手指离开屏幕时,如果和上一次 move 时的间隔小于 `MOMENTUM_LIMIT_TIME` 且 move // 距离大于 `MOMENTUM_LIMIT_DISTANCE` 时,执行惯性滑动 MOMENTUM_LIMIT_TIME = 30; MOMENTUM_LIMIT_...
实现CSS { margin: 0; padding: 0;}.btn { height: 32px; padding: 0 15px; text-align: center; font-size: 14px; line-height: 32px; color: #FFF; border: none; background: #1890ff; border-radius: 2px; cursor: pointer;}.mask { position: fixed; top: 0; left: 0; ri...
js 选择控件 picker 首先预览图效果: 概述: 只是一个选择器,选择器内可以有多个分类,但输入目标只有一个.比较适合上图所示的情况:需要用户选择一个开始时间,且时间是限定死的,这个开始时间可能是昨天今天或明天。这个插件就是用来解决这个问题的,我不是一个前端工程师,所以代码的依赖 JQuery,样式是从bootstrap-...
Picker.js是一个纯用js+css3 transition特性构建的纯h5滚动选择器,它能实现近似原生IOS datePicker的滚动选择效果,同时利用js回调函数捕捉常用的几个自定义事件来实现几列菜单级联效果。而且它可以让你自定义列数,支持1-3列列表,一个picker搞定各种菜单栏。 Picker.js 总体介绍如下: 1、引入方式 依赖zepto.js 和gm...
选择器,支持多 slot 联动。 引入 代码语言:javascript 复制 import{Picker}from'mint-ui';Vue.component(Picker.name,Picker); 例子 传入slots,当被选中的值发生变化时触发change事件。change事件有两个参数,分别为当前picker的 vue 实例和各 slot 被选中的值组成的数组 ...
传入参数,实例化一个picker 实例方法为 new Picker(options) ,一个最简单的例子如下: var fruit = ['苹果','香蕉','火龙果','芒果','百香果']; new Picker({ target: 'fruit', data: fruit }); 其中,target为触发picker显示的目标元素,值为元素的id或者dom元素,data为需要实例化供选择的数据集...
Step2、在 JS 文件中定义变量startDateIndex和endDateIndex,分别用于保存用户选择的入住日期和离开日期的时间戳,还需要checkMaxDate来设置入住日期的最大日期范围,checkMinDate来设置离开日期的的最小日期范围。 Step3、在设置入住日期和离开日期的picker组件时,可以使用bindchange事件监听用户选择的日期,并...
weui中的picker使用js进行动态绑定数据问题 解决方案; picker和Select组件是通过input标签绑定,可以先通过input的父级元素移除input标签,重新插入input标签,最后重新初始化picker或Select组件。 性别 AI代码助手复制代码 js代码: $("#appl_sex").picker({title:"请选择",cols: [ {textAlign:'center...
JavaScript date time picker.. Latest version: 1.2.1, last published: 6 years ago. Start using pickerjs in your project by running `npm i pickerjs`. There are 2 other projects in the npm registry using pickerjs.